Michael Mahan named to Board of Trustees
Michael A. Mahan, an operations manager with Staples Inc. and an accomplished business and technology consultant, was recently sworn in as a member of the Fitchburg State University Board of Trustees.
Mahan’s duties at Staples include responsibility, within the information technology organization, for a multimillion-dollar program to streamline operations and profitability for Staples.com.
Prior to that post, Mahan worked as a principal of real estate and operations for CA Technologies in Framingham, where he was responsible for the real estate and mergers & acquisitions needs of the R&D organization. He also served as a department manager for PCI/Wolters Kluwer Financial Services in Boston and worked as a management and technology consultant for Accenture and PricewaterhouseCoopers.
Mahan earned a bachelor of science in industrial engineering from Worcester Polytechnic Institute in 2001 and a master of business administration from Boston College’s Carroll School of Management in 2008.
His civic involvement includes serving on the board of directors of the Thayer Symphony Orchestra, having previously served as its president, and as a member of the city of Leominster’s water and sewer commission. He has already lent his talents to Fitchburg State as a member of the board of directors for the Fitchburg State University Foundation, Inc., where he was a member of its finance committee.
Mahan, his wife Heather, and their daughter live in Leominster.
